アプリケーションを強制終了          <TOP>


致命的なアプリケーション終了」というメッセージボックスを表示させ、即座にプログラムを終了させることが出来ます。

FatalAppExit メッセージボックスを表示して、アプリケーションを終了

 

 

 

'================================================================
'= アプリケーションを強制終了
'=    (FatalAppExit.bas)
'================================================================
#include "Windows.bi"

' メッセージボックスを表示して、アプリケーションを終了
Declare Sub Api_FatalAppExit Lib "kernel32" Alias "FatalAppExitA" (ByVal uAction&, ByVal lpMessageText$)

'================================================================
'=
'================================================================
Declare Sub Button1_on edecl ()
Sub Button1_on()
    Var MSG As String
    
    MSG = "強制終了します。"   'メッセージボックスに表示する文字列を指定
    Api_FatalAppExit 0, MSG    'アプリケーションの強制終了を実行

End Sub

'================================================================
'=
'================================================================
While 1
    WaitEvent
Wend
Stop
End